WebMar 15, 2024 · Using git diff for comparing branches. For seeing the changes between different branches we will use the command git diff name_of _the_branch1 name_of_the_branch2. WebExample: after rebasing a branch my-topic, git range-diff my-topic@{u} my-topic@{1} my-topic would show the differences introduced by the rebase. git range-diff also accepts the regular diff options (see git-diff(1)), most notably the --color=[] and --no-color options. These options are used when generating the "diff between patches", i.e ...
